is it worth running 2.2 tires on a scx10, it looks awesome but does it do anything for performance

yes it does alot for performance i ran mine with 1.9 for about 10 mins when i got it then put my 2.2 rovers on and i think i swapped back once or twice when i was board but the difference is huge i also run losi 4in shocks for more clearance and suspension travel. But since then i got the dinky summit cradle and summit trans so with that loss of gc i don't think i can go 1.9 again. Also there is a big difference in speed from the size of the tire unless you change your gearing.

I've done the 1.9 to 2.2, 1.9 to 2.2 thing. After experimenting ,I think the 1.9's, due to less un-sprung weight and just plain less mass do better actually than 2.2's on a SCX anyways. Rok-Lox in a 1.9 measure as tall as a lot of 2.2's but weight less, yes, the contact-patch is less but at least they look scale.
Using a 1/8th scale tire on a 10th scale makes it easy. It takes skill to do what a 2.2 rig will do on 1.9's.
